What companies run services between Budapest, Hungary and Burgenland, Austria?

You can take a train from Budapest-Kelenföld to Eisenstadt via Hegyeshalom and Parndorf Ort in around 3h 8m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Budapest, Népliget Autóbusz-Pályaudvar to Eisenstadt Domplatz via Vienna, Central Station Südtiroler Platz and Wien Hauptbahnhof in around 5h 21m.
